WebDefinition and Usage. The getElementById () method returns an element with a specified value. The getElementById () method returns null if the element does not exist. The getElementById () method is one of the most common methods in the HTML DOM. It is used almost every time you want to read or edit an HTML element. WebThe id attribute specifies a unique id for an HTML element. The value of the id attribute must be unique within the HTML document. The id attribute is used to point to a specific style declaration in a style sheet. It is also used by JavaScript to access and manipulate the element with the specific id. WebApr 7, 2024 · Event.currentTarget is interesting to use when attaching the same event handler to several elements. Note: The value of event.currentTarget is only available while the event is being handled. If you console.log () the event object, storing it in a variable, and then look for the currentTarget key in the console, its value will be null. WebFeb 21, 2024 · The CSS ID selector matches an element based on the value of the element's id attribute. In order for the element to be selected, its id attribute must match exactly the value given in the selector. ... JavaScript. General-purpose scripting language. HTTP. WebAug 12, 2024 · button.addEventListener("click", (evt) => { console.log(evt.target.parentNode.dataset.id); // prints "123" }); In this very case, the Node.parentNode API is sufficient. What it does is return the parent node of a given element.
